The wheat and chessboard problem (sometimes expressed in … Web13 de mai. de 2024 · The United States Chess Federation (USCF) states that square size should be anywhere from 2 inches to 2.5 inches, while the king's height should be 3.375 inches to 4.5 inches. The standard USCF tournament set has 2.25 inch squares and a king's height of 3.75 inches. optum 2405 research parkway fax https://thebankbcn.com

Web25, 4x4 squares. 36, 3x3 squares. 49, 2x2 squares. 64, 1x1 squares. Therefore, there are actually 64 + 49 + 36 + 25 + 16 + 9 + 4 + 1 squares on a chessboard! (in total 204). Web30 de ago. de 2024 · Possible solution, maybe not the most elegant, but you can create the squares in a loop. #Size of squares size = 20 #board length, must be even boardLength = 8 gameDisplay.fill(white) cnt = 0 for i in range(1,boardLength+1): for z in range(1,boardLength+1): #check if current loop value is even if cnt % 2 == 0: … Web2 de set. de 2008 · This is a chessboard of 8x8 surrounded by sentinel squares (e.g. a 255 to indicate that a piece can't move to this square). The sentinels have a depth of two so that a knight can't jump over. To move right add 1. To move left add -1. Up 10, down -10, up and right diagonal 11 etc. Square A1 is index 21. H1 is index 29. H8 is index 99.
